Many misses come from confusing MVP vs. Cy Young seasons, mixing up AL/NL award recipients, or assuming a player won ROY because they had an early breakout. Another trap is overvaluing famous careers—some legends never won certain awards, while lesser-known seasons produced surprise winners.
